NanaZip: Null-pointer dereference in NanaZip UFS parser when root inode is a symlink
Summary
NanaZip is an open source file archive. From 5.0.1252.0 to before 6.0.1698.0, a null-pointer dereference exists in the UFS/UFS2 filesystem image parser in NanaZip. The vulnerability is triggered when opening a crafted UFS image where the root inode (inode 2) is set to IFLNK (symlink) instead of IFDIR (directory). The parser unconditionally treats the root inode as a directory without checking its type, and when the symlink has an embedded target (small di_size), the directory data buffer is zero-length, causing a null-pointer dereference on the first read. This vulnerability is fixed in 6.0.1698.0.

free5GC: PCF npcf-smpolicycontrol POST /sm-policies panics on downstream UDR/OpenAPI 404 via nil pointer dereference
Summary
free5GC is an open-source implementation of the 5G core network. Prior to 4.2.2, free5GC's PCF POST /npcf-smpolicycontrol/v1/sm-policies handler (HandleCreateSmPolicyRequest) panics with a nil-pointer dereference when a downstream OpenAPI consumer call (UDR lookup) returns 404 Not Found and the consumer wrapper returns err != nil together with a nil response struct. The handler logs the OpenAPI error and continues executing instead of returning, then dereferences the nil response struct on a subsequent line and panics. Gin recovery converts the panic into HTTP 500, so a single attacker-shaped POST returns 500 instead of a clean 4xx whenever the downstream lookup fails. The PCF process keeps running. The trigger is a single POST containing input that causes the downstream UDR lookup to fail (e.g. an unknown DNN). In 4.2.1 this endpoint is also reachable WITHOUT an Authorization header because the PCF Npcf_SMPolicyControl route group is mounted without inbound auth middleware. This vulnerability is fixed in 4.2.2.

free5GC: PCF npcf-policyauthorization POST /app-sessions panics on suppFeat=1 with missing AfRoutReq via nil pointer dereference
Summary
free5GC is an open-source implementation of the 5G core network. Prior to 4.2.2, free5GC's PCF POST /npcf-policyauthorization/v1/app-sessions handler panics on a single authenticated request whose ascReqData.suppFeat == "1" (enabling traffic-routing feature negotiation) and whose medComponents entries supply an afAppId but NO AfRoutReq. The create path then calls provisioningOfTrafficRoutingInfo(smPolicy, appID, routeReq, ...) with routeReq == nil and dereferences routeReq.RouteToLocs (and other fields) without a nil check, causing runtime error: invalid memory address or nil pointer dereference. Gin recovery converts the panic into HTTP 500. This vulnerability is fixed in 4.2.2.

free5GC: NEF 3gpp-pfd-management PATCH applications/{appId} panics on UDR access failure due to nil ProblemDetails dereference
Summary
free5GC is an open-source implementation of the 5G core network. Prior to 4.2.2, free5GC's NEF PATCH /3gpp-pfd-management/v1/{afId}/transactions/{transId}/applications/{appId} handler panics with a nil-pointer dereference when the upstream UDR call fails AND the consumer wrapper returns err != nil together with a nil *ProblemDetails. The handler's errPfdData != nil branch builds its own problemDetailsErr correctly, but immediately after it reads problemDetails.Cause (the OTHER value, which is nil in this branch) and panics. Gin recovery converts the panic into HTTP 500, so a single PATCH against this endpoint returns 500 instead of the intended controlled error response whenever UDR access is failing. This vulnerability is fixed in 4.2.2.

free5GC: UDR nudr-dr DELETE amf-subscriptions panics on missing subsId when UE state exists (nil pointer dereference)
Summary
free5GC is an open-source implementation of the 5G core network. Prior to 4.2.2, free5GC's UDR nudr-dr DELETE /subscription-data/{ueId}/{servingPlmnId}/ee-subscriptions/{subsId}/amf-subscriptions handler contains a nil-pointer dereference reachable from a single authenticated request, after one preparatory authenticated EE-subscription create. The handler checks _, ok = UESubsData.EeSubscriptionCollection[subsId] and sets a 404 problem-details on the miss path, but then continues to UESubsData.EeSubscriptionCollection[subsId].AmfSubscriptionInfos -- dereferencing the same missing entry instead of returning. Gin recovery converts the panic into HTTP 500, but the endpoint remains repeatedly panicable. This vulnerability is fixed in 4.2.2.

free5GC: SMF UPI DELETE /upi/v1/upNodesLinks/{ref} panics on AN-node deletion via nil UPF dereference; unauthenticated, state-mutating
Summary
free5GC is an open-source implementation of the 5G core network. Prior to 4.2.2, free5GC's SMF mounts the UPI management route group without inbound OAuth2 middleware. On top of that, the DELETE /upi/v1/upNodesLinks/{upNodeRef} handler unconditionally dereferences upNode.UPF after the type-guarded async release, even though AN-typed nodes are constructed without a UPF object. As a result, a single unauthenticated DELETE /upi/v1/upNodesLinks/gNB1 request crashes the handler with a nil-pointer panic AND mutates the in-memory user-plane topology before panicking (the UpNodeDelete(upNodeRef) line runs first). This is an unauthenticated, state-mutating panic-DoS sink that an off-path network attacker can trigger by name against any AN entry. This vulnerability is fixed in 4.2.2.

libsixel: NULL pointer dereference
Summary
libsixel is a SIXEL encoder/decoder implementation derived from kmiya's sixel. From to 1.8.7-r1, a wrong NULL check after an allocation call in sixel_decode_raw and sixel_decode causes a NULL pointer dereference whenever the allocation fails. The check tests the address of the output parameter (always non-NULL) instead of the value the malloc returned. On allocation failure, the function continues and writes through a NULL pointer, crashing the process. This is a denial of service against any caller of these public APIs that hits a low-memory condition. This vulnerability is fixed in 1.8.7-r2.

Mitigation ID: MIT-56

Phase: Implementation

Description:

  • For any pointers that could have been modified or provided from a function that can return NULL, check the pointer for NULL before use. When working with a multithreaded or otherwise asynchronous environment, ensure that proper locking APIs are used to lock before the check, and unlock when it has finished [REF-1484].
Mitigation

Phase: Requirements

Description:

  • Select a programming language that is not susceptible to these issues.
Mitigation

Phase: Implementation

Description:

  • Check the results of all functions that return a value and verify that the value is non-null before acting upon it.
Mitigation

Phase: Architecture and Design

Description:

  • Identify all variables and data stores that receive information from external sources, and apply input validation to make sure that they are only initialized to expected values.
Mitigation

Phase: Implementation

Description:

  • Explicitly initialize all variables and other data stores, either during declaration or just before the first usage.
